Our client, the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ania, is seeking a technically strong and customer-service-oriented NOC Communications Specialist to provide Level 1 network and end-user support during overnight and weekend hours.
This position serves as a primary after-hours contact for Commonwealth employees, business partners, vendors, and IT teams experiencing network-related issues.
The ideal candidate should be comfortable working independently during an overnight shift, troubleshooting basic network and end-user issues, monitoring network environments, creating and escalating ServiceNow tickets, and following established procedures and knowledgebase documentation.
The strongest candidate will be a Help Desk, NOC, Technical Support, or Junior Systems Administrator professional with 2+ years of experience who has strong communication skills, ServiceNow/ticketing experience, basic network troubleshooting knowledge, and is comfortable working an overnight schedule in a 24x7 operational environment.
